*Spiritual nutrition* is about understanding how the energetic components of everything we consume affects our wellbeing. Ayurveda says that we are digesting everything that exists in our reality and it becomes a part of us. Hi, I'm Jeffrey and I am a Feldenkrais Method and Kinēsa practitioner. Feldenkrais and Kinesa are somatic practices that focus primarily on helping people become aware of the invisible, habitual choices they make. What we don't know we're doing is where the gold is. Through experimentation, you can find new and better choices. We use movement as the primary vehicle for exploration. But why movement? People are numb and disconnected from their bodies.
